Summary

Under the direction of department management and according to policies and procedures as defined in the Department Policy and Procedure Manuals, the Respiratory Therapist, Senior demonstrates an advanced level of knowledge in respiratory care and assigned patient care areas. The Respiratory Therapist II administers competent care of patients through airway management, mechanical ventilator management, oxygen therapy, aerosol therapy, respiratory care procedures and treatments designed to assess, prevent, stabilize or remedy patients respiratory dysfunction.

Responsibilities
  1. Administers standard Respiratory Care including but not limited to aerosol medication delivery, basic bedside pulmonary function testing, breathing exercises, oxygen therapy (Not included in Per Diem Job) and arterial punctures. Provides for all aspects of airway management including aspiration of established airways, tracheostomy care, tracheostomy tube changes, endotracheal intubations and extubations. May perform Pulmonary Function Testing as needed.
  2. May be required to be on‑call days, nights, weekends and holidays.
  3. May perform all aspects of ventilator care to include, but not limited to setting up the ventilator and verifying function using specialized ventilator modes to manage the patients disease process. Provide for an appropriate monitoring of these patients and provide appropriate weaning techniques.
  4. Maintains and improves job knowledge and skills. Functions independently with minimal supervision. Serves as resource to other staff reflective of experience level.
Other Information
Education Requirements
  • Graduation from an accredited Respiratory Therapy program.
Licensure/Certification Requirements
  • Licensed as a Respiratory Care Practitioner by the North Carolina Respiratory Care Board. Must be registered (RRT) by the National Board of Respiratory Care. Note: Current teammates with active Certified Respiratory Therapist (CRT) certification by the NBRC and a minimum of 15 years of experience as a CRT and are ineligible for the RRT board exam with demonstrated proficiency in all aspects of respiratory care also qualify for this role. Dependent upon population served and regardless of if RRT or CRT, all teammates must have at least one of the following depending upon practice area: Advanced Cardiac Life Support (ACLS) – Adult Care, Neonatal Resuscitation Program (NRP) – NICU, Pediatric Advanced Life Support (PALS) – PICU/Rex, Certified Pulmonary Function Technologist (CPFT), or advanced practice certificate to administer moderate sedation in Bronchoscopy Lab. All certifications must be maintained as required by the certifying body.
Professional Experience Requirements
  • Two (2) years of experience as a Respiratory Therapist.
Knowledge/Skills/and Abilities Requirements
  • Ability to read, analyze, and interpret clinical information and technical procedures. Ability to document clinical information. Ability to effectively communicate information and respond to questions from patients, physicians, family members, and other staff.
  • Mathematical Skills: Ability to apply concepts such as fractions, percentages, ratios, and proportions to practical situations.
  • Reasoning Ability: Ability to define problems, collect data, establish facts, and draw valid conclusions. Ability to interpret an extensive variety of technical situations.
